He married Aura Adams October 4, 1883, in Wayne County, Iowa.
In April 1885 they were counted in the Iowa State census in Benton Township, as were Samuel's parents. They migrated to Idaho sometimes after the birth of their daughter Edna in July 1890.
At the time of the 1900 census, they were counted in Boise, Ada County, and Sam listed his occupation as a carpenter. In 1910 they were also counted Boise and Sam's occupation was carpenter. At the time of 1920 census, they were counted on North 19th Street, in Boise and the household included their 14-year old Austrian-born adopted daugther, Helen. Sam died December 30, 1933, in Boise.
-- marriage information from Lorena Estlow Hyde's unpublished McConnel History, 1983
